Sometimes it's not easy to identify a mainboard even if the Bios-ID is given .
Maybe add to the guidelinnes to Post the Bios OEM signon - the message just below AMI or AWARD Bios message or Logo - maybe with a picture added(if possible)
Image

Another picture with a Bios-ID from Award or AMI will help too .
Or a complete screenshot from the startup screen with both the Bios-ID and OEM signon message
